مع انتشار تقنية الحوسبة السحابية، أصبح هناك حاجة متزايدة من قبل المطورين الأفراد والشركات الصغيرة والمتوسطة إلى حلول خادمة مرنة وذات تكلفة معقولة. عندما لا تكون موارد الخوادم المشتركة كافية لتلبية الاحتياجات، ظهر مفهوم الخادم الافتراضي المخصص (Virtual Private Server). يوفر هذا المفهوم لكل مستخدم بيئة خادم افتراضية مستقلة ومعزولة، مما يتيح له الاستمتاع بصلاحيات إدارة النظام الكاملة دون الحاجة إلى تحمل التكاليف العالية للخوادم الفعلية.
المفاهيم الأساسية وآلية عمل خوادم VPS (Virtual Private Servers)
الخادم الخاص الافتراضي (Virtual Private Server) يعتمد في جوهره على تقنية “التحويل الافتراضي” (Virtualization). حيث يقوم بتقسيم خادم فيزيائي قوي إلى عدة بيئات افتراضية معزولة عن بعضها البعض، وذلك باستخدام برامج متخص
أنواع تقنيات الافتراضية (Virtualization Technologies)
تنقسم التقنيات الرئيسية للتجريد الافتراضي حاليًا إلى فئتين رئيسيتين: التجريد الافتراضي الكامل والتجريد على مستوى نظام التشغيل. يوفر التجريد الافتراضي الكامل، مثل KVM وVMware، بيئة هاردوير كاملة محاكاة لكل خادم افتراضي (VPS)، مما يسمح بتشغيل أي نظام تشغيل. أما التجريد على مستوى نظام التشغيل، مثل OpenVZ وLXC، فيشترك في نواة الخادم الأم، وجميع الخوادم الافتراضية تعمل بنفس إصدار نظام التشغيل، مما يوفر كفاءة أعلى لكن مع مرونة أقل.
القراءة الموصى بها دليل اختيار خوادم VPS: المعرفة الأساسية والنصائح العملية من المبتدئين إلى المحترفين。
توزيع الموارد والعزلة.
يتم تخصيص موارد هاردويرية أساسية لكل خادم VPS، مثل عدد وحدات المعالجة المركزية (CPU)، وحجم الذاكرة، ومساحة التخزين، وعرض النطاق الترددي للشبكة. تستخدم شركات خدمات VPS عالية الجودة تقنيات “العزل الهاردي” لضمان عدم استخدام موارد الخادم الخاص بك بشكل مفرط من قبل مستخدمين آخرين على نفس الخادم الفعلي، مما يحافظ على استقرار الأداء. يعتبر هذا العزل الميزة الأساسية التي تميز خدمات VPS عن خدمات السيرفرات المشتركة.
كيفية اختيار خادم VPS مناسب لاحتياجاتك
في مواجهة العديد من مزودي الخدمات والخطط التكوينية المعقدة في السوق، من الضروري جدًا اتخاذ قرارات حكيمة. يعتمد ذلك بشكل أساسي على سيناريو التطبيق الخاص بك ومستوى مهاراتك التقنية.
تحديد احتياجاتك الخاصة.
قبل اتخاذ القرار، يجب عليك أولاً الإجابة على بعض الأسئلة: ما هو عدد الزيارات المتوقعة لموقعك الإلكتروني أو تطبيقك؟ إلى أي مناطق ستكون الخدمة موجهة بشكل رئيسي؟ هل هناك حاجة لتشغيل برامج أو بيئات معينة؟ ما هو الميزانية المتاحة لديك؟ متطلبات VPS لموقع إلكتروني تقديمي ومشروع تدريب نموذج الذكاء الاصطناعي مختل
تفسير معايير الأداء الرئيسية
وحدة المعالجة المركزية (CPU) والذاكرة: عدد نوى وحدة المعالجة المركزية يحدد القدرة على المعالجة المتزامنة، بينما يؤثر حجم الذاكرة بشكل مباشر على عدد الخدمات التي يمكن تشغيلها في نفس الوقت. بالنسبة للمواقع الإلكترونية الديناميكية (مثل وور
نوع التخزين: الأقراص الصلبة التقليدية (HDD) ذات الأسعار المنخفضة والسعة الكبيرة، ولكنها بطيئة. تتميز الأقراص الصلبة ذات حالة التيار المستمر (SSD) بسرعتها العالية، ويمكنها تحسين أوقات استجابة النظام وقواعد البيانات بشكل كبير. أما الأقراص الصلبة ذات حالة التيار المستمر (NVMe SSD) فهي خيار أعلى، حيث تتميز بسرعات قراءة وكتابة عالية جدًا.
العرض النطاقي وحجم البيانات: يشير العرض النطاقي إلى معدل نقل البيانات في اللحظة الحالية، بينما يشير حجم البيانات إلى إجمالي حجم البيانات المسموح بنقلها كل شهر. يجب الانتباه إلى الفرق بين “العرض النطاقي المشترك” و“العرض النطاقي المضمون”، وما إذا كان حجم البيانات “محسوبًا في الاتجاه الصاعد” أو “محسوبًا في الاتجاهين”.
موقع مركز البيانات: اختر مركز بيانات يقع بالقرب من مجموعة المستخدمين المستهدفة لديك، حيث يمكن أن يقلل ذلك بشكل كبير من زمن التأخير في الشبكة ويحسن سرعة الوصول.
اختيار مزودي الخدمات وأنظمة التشغيل
عادةً ما توفر الشركات المعروفة ضمانات أفضل من حيث استقرار الشبكة والدعم الفني. بالنسبة لأنظمة التشغيل، يمكن للمبتدئين البدء باستخدام أنظمة مثل Ubuntu أو CentOS التي تحتوي على واجهات رسومية. إذا كنت تسعى إلى أداء ممتاز وقابلية تحكم عالية، فيمكنك اختيار إصدارات لينكس التي تعمل عبر سطر الأوامر، أو يمكنك اختيار Windows Server حسب احتياجاتك.
القراءة الموصى بها كيفية اختيار استضافة VPS المناسبة: دليل شراء شامل من المبتدئ إلى الاحتراف。
أفضل الممارسات للإعدادات الأمنية الأولية
قبل بدء نشر التطبيق، من الضروري إجراء سلسلة من التدابير الأساسية لتعزيز الأمان، وهذا يمكن أن يساعد بشكل فعال في منع معظم سكريبتات الهجمات الآلية.
المستخدمون وتعزيز أمان بروتوكول SSH
المهمة الأولى هي تعطيل تسجيل الدخول المباشر لمستخدم “root” عبر بروتوكول SSH، وإنشاء مستخدم عادي يمتلك صلاحيات “sudo”. بالإضافة إلى ذلك، يجب تغيير الرقم الافتراضي لبروتوكول SSH (22) إلى رقم عشوائي أعلى، وإجبار المستخدمين على استخدام زوج من مفاتيح SSH للتحقق من هويتهم، مما يؤدي إلى تعطيل تسجيل الدخول باستخدام الكلمات المرورية بشكل كامل. هذه الإجراءات ستساعد في صد معظم محاولات الاختراق العشو
تكوين جدار الحماية
استخدم أداة الحاجز الناري المدمجة في النظام (مثل تلك المتوفرة في لينكس).iptablesأو أكثر سهولة في الاستخدامufwيجب السيطرة بشكل صارم على حركة المرور الداخلة والخارجة. المبدأ الأساسي هو فتح المنافذ الضرورية فقط. على سبيل المثال، بالنسبة لخوادم الويب، عادةً ما يتم فتح المنافذ 80 (HTTP) و443 (HTTPS) بالإضافة إلى منفذ SSH الذي قمت بتعديله، ورفض جميع الاتصالات الواردة غير الضرورية.
تحديثات النظام ومراجعات الأمان
اعتد على تحديث حزم برمجيات النظام بشكل دوري لتصحيح الثغرات الأمنية المعروفة في الوقت المناسب. يمكن ضبط عمليات التحديث لتتم تلقائيًا دون الحاجة إلى تدخل من المستخدم. بالإضافة إلى ذلك، يمكfail2banهذا الأداة قادر على مراقبة سجلات النظام، وعند اكتشاف سلوكيات خبيثة مثل فشل عمليات تسجيل الدخول مرارًا وتكرارًا، فإنه يقوم تلقائيًا بإضافة عنوان IP الخاص بمصدر الهجوم إلى قائ
النشر والإدارة في البيئات الشائعة
خادم VPS مُعدّ بشكل آمن يُعتبر "اللوح"، بينما بيئات الخدمات الويب وقواعد البيانات وما إلى ذلك تُعتبر "اللوحات الزيتية" المرسومة على هذا اللوح. فيما يلي بعض الأفكار الأساسية لإعداد هذه
بيئة خادم الويب (Web Server Environment)
الأكثر شيوعًا هو استخدام مكدسات LAMP (Linux، Apache، MySQL، PHP) وLNMP (Linux، Nginx، MySQL، PHP). يتمتع Nginx بميزة كبيرة في معالجة الطلبات الثابتة عالية الكثافة، وغالبًا ما يُستخدم كوكيل عكسي بالتزامن مع Apache. في الوقت الحالي، أصبح استخدام حاويات Docker لنشر هذه البيئات أكثر شيوعًا، حيث يوفر عزلًا أفضل للبيئات وإدارة أفضل للمعتمدات، كما أن عمليات النشر والنقل أصبحت أسهل.
القراءة الموصى بها دليل شامل لاختيار مضيف VPS: كيف تبدأ بسرعة ودليل التهيئة.。
تثبيت وإدارة قواعد البيانات
MySQL وفرعه MariaDB هما الخياران الرئيسيان لقواعد البيانات العلاقية. بعد التثبيت، من الضروري تشغيل سكريبت التثبيت الأمني، وتعيين كلمة مرور قوية لمستخدم “root”, وإزالة المستخدم التجريبي الغير معروف. بالنسبة لخوادم VPS ذات الذاكرة المحدودة، يجب تحسين إعدادات قاعدة البيانات، مثل تعديل حجم حزمة التخزين المؤقت (buffer pool)، لتجنب استنفاد الذاكرة وتسببه في توقف الخدمة.
استخدم الواجهات الرسومية لتبسيط عملية الإدارة.
بالنسبة للمستخدمين غير المعتادين على التعامل مع سطر الأوامر، فإن لوحة التحكم تعتبر أداة مفيدة للغاية. على سبيل المثال، لوحة Baota توفر واجهة رسومية سهلة الاستخدام، تسمح بإنشاء وإدارة المواقع الإلكترونية وخدمات FTP وقواعد البيانات بسهولة، بالإضافة إلى إمكانية تثبيت التطبيقات المختلفة بنقرة واحدة، وتكوين شهادات SSL، وإجراء عمليات النسخ الاحتياطي التل
الملخصات
تكمن قوة خوادم VPS في أنها توفر للمستخدمين بيئة حوسبة عالية الحرية والقابلية للتحكم. يبدأ الأمر بفهم مبادئ الافتراضية (virtualization)، ثم يلي ذلك اختيار الإعدادات المناسبة بعناية وفقًا للاحتياجات، ومن ثم تعزيز أمان النظام لوضع الأساس الصلب، وأخيرًا نشر البيئة التشغيلية المطلوبة. هذه عملية تعلم وممارسة منهجية. إتقان مهارات إدارة خوادم VPS لا يسمح لك فقط بإدارة مشاريعك بشكل أفضل، بل يعزز أيضًا فهمك لتقنيات الحوسبة السحابية وصيانة الأنظمة، وهو مهارة ثمينة في مسار نموك التقني.
الأسئلة الشائعة الأسئلة المتداولة
ما الفرق بين خدمات VPS (Virtual Private Server)، والخوادم الافتراضية (Virtual Hosts)، وخوادم السحابة (Cloud Servers)؟
الخادم الافتراضي (Virtual Host) هو نظام يسمح لعدة مواقع إلكترونية بمشاركة موارد الخادم نفسه؛ تكون صلاحيات المستخدمين محدودة، مما يجعل الإدارة أسهل، لكن قابلية التوسع ضعيفة. أما الخادم الافتراضي الخاص (VPS – Virtual Private Server) فهو جزء افتراضي مستقل مستمد من خادم فعلي، ويتمتع بصلاحيات الوصول الكاملة (root) وموارد خاصة به، ويعتبر ترقية لنظام الخادم الافتراضي العادي. أما الخوادم السحابية (Cloud Servers) فهي عادةً ما تع
ما الخطوة الأولى التي يجب اتخاذها بعد شراء VPS؟
الخطوة الأولى بعد الشراء بالتأكيد ليست نشر الموقع الإلكتروني. يجب عليك تسجيل الدخول إلى الخادم فورًا واتباع “أفضل الممارسات الأمنية الأساسية” المذكورة سابقًا: إنشاء مستخدم عادي، تعطيل تسجيل الدخول عبر SSH لحساب root، تغيير معرفة منفذ SSH، وضبط قواعد الحماية (الجدار الناري). تأكد من أمان الخادم قبل القيام بأي إجراءات أخرى.
لماذا تكون سرعة الوصول إلى VPS الخاص بي بطيئة جدًا؟
قد يكون بطء السرعة ناتجًا عن عدة أسباب. أولاً، تحقق من موقع مركز البيانات لمعرفة ما إذا كان بعيدًا عن المستخدمين الذين يقومون بالوصول إلى الخدمات. ثانيًا، استخدم أدوات لاختبار مسار الاتصال الشبكي من الجهاز المحلي إلى الخادم ومعدل فقدان البيانات. أخيرًا، قم بتسجيل الدخول إلى الخادم للتحقق مما إذا كانت موارد الخادم (مثل وحدة المعالجة المركزية، الذاكرة، وعمليات الإدخال/الإخرا
كيف يمكنني عمل نسخة احتياطية من بيانات VPS الخاصة بي؟
إن إجراء النسخ الاحتياطية بشكل دوري أمر في غاية الأهمية. يمكنك استخدام عدة طرق لذلك: يمكنك الاستفادة من خاصية الصور السريعة (snapshots) المتاحة لدى مزودي الخدمة (إن وجدت)، والتي تسمح بحفظ حالة الخادم بشكل كامل في لrsyncتقوم هذه الأمر بمزامنة ملفات الموقع الإلكتروني وقاعدة البيانات بشكل تدريجي إلى مساحة تخزين أخرى. باستخدام أدوات مثل “باوتا” (BaoTa)، يمكن ضبط عمليات النسخ الاحتياطي التلقائي وتوجيهها إلى خدمات التخزين الس
ما الذي يمكن استخدام خدمة الـ VPS (خادم شخصي مفترض) من أجله؟
تتعدد استخدامات خدمات الـ VPS (Virtual Private Server) بشكل كبير. أكثر الاستخدامات شيوعًا هو إنشاء المواقع الإلكترونية، والمدونات، أو منصات التجارة الإلكترونية. يمكن للمطورين استخدامها لنشر بيئات الاختبار، أو إنشاء مستودعات خاصة للـ Git، أو كخوادم لعمليات الدمج المستمر (Continuous Integration). كما يمكن استخدامها لتشغيل خوادم الألعاب، أو الأقراص السحابية الشخصية، أو أنظمة سطح المكتب عن بعد، أو بوابات الشبكات الخاصة للشركات (VPN)، بالإضافة إلى تشغيل برامج الزحف (Crawlers)، وال
ما التالي، ما التالي؟
القراءة الموسعة والمعرفة العملية
فيما يلي بعض الموضوعات ذات الصلة بموضوع هذه المقالة وهي مناسبة لمزيد من القراءة المتعمقة. وغالباً ما يكون من الأفضل إعطاء الأولوية للبدء بالمقال الأقرب إلى مشكلتك الحالية ثم التوسع تدريجياً إلى المواضيع المحيطة.
- تحليل شامل لخوادم الشراكة: دليل كامل من اختيار النوع إلى تحسين الأداء
- دليل نهائي لتحسين أداء ووردبريس المتقدم: خطوات عملية لزيادة السرعة وتحسين ترتيب الموقع في محركات البحث (SEO) وزيادة معدلات التحويل
- دليل شامل لخوادم السحابة: من المبتدئين إلى المحترفين، امتلاك معرفة شاملة بأساسيات النشر والإدارة في السحابة
- كيفية اختيار خادم مستقل: دليل شامل ونهائي من التكوين إلى الاستضافة
- دليل شراء وتكوين الخوادم المستقلة: كيف تختار الخادم الخاص بك الأنسب